The Open Jacket Layer
This is the most timeless and consistently appealing layering approach, and it performs remarkably well with Palm Angels designer tees. The concept is easy: wear your tee as the aesthetic centerpiece and drape an open jacket over it as a frame. The trick is opting for a jacket that enhances the tee’s design without vying for attention. A solid-colored Palm Angels nylon bomber in black or navy ($1,100 to $1,500) forms a clean border around a detailed graphic tee, directing the eye to the print while contributing architectural complexity to the outfit. Instead, a denim jacket with minimal distressing ($850 to $1,200) brings textural variation that makes the cotton tee stand out. The concept of proportions matters here — since Palm Angels tees skew to be loose, go with a jacket that equals or a bit goes beyond the tee’s length. A above-waist jacket over a dropped-hem tee produces an deliberate streetwear silhouette that has palm angels pants for sale defined fashion weeks from Milan to Tokyo throughout 2025 and 2026. Keep the jacket entirely unzipped or unbuttoned so the tee’s print remains showing, which is the entire point of this layering strategy.
For warmer weather, substitute the jacket with an open overshirt or thin flannel. Palm Angels provides several overshirt options in their seasonal collections ($450 to $700), and the casual cut layers seamlessly over their tees without creating unwanted warmth. When color-matching, shoot for hue coordination rather than exact matching — a tee with a purple design combines perfectly under a washed-out lavender overshirt, while a tee with orange flame motifs pairs unexpectedly well with an olive or earth-tone jacket. The Hoodie-Under-Jacket Setup
For colder months or just for top visual punch, the three-layer ensemble — tee, hoodie, jacket — is a formidable approach. Start with a tailored or moderately generous Palm Angels tee as your base, add a zip-up hoodie (halfway unzipped to flash the tee under it), and top everything with a defined outer layer like a parka, overcoat, or puffer jacket. This technique generates a progression of layered layers at the neckline and hem that gives the combination meaningful depth. The essential element is managing bulk: each following layer should be a bit more spacious than the one beneath it, creating a natural graduation rather than a stuffed restrictive silhouette. Palm Angels hoodies ($550 to $750) are designed with this kind of layering in mind — their sizing handle a tee beneath without gathering, and their slim-but-relaxed cut moves effortlessly under outerwear. Use this technique when the thermometer drop below 10 degrees Celsius or when attending after-dark events where you need a look with real gravitas.
Color coordination across three layers necessitates a thoughtful approach. The most reliable strategy is the “one hero, two neutrals” formula: let one layer (commonly the tee or the outer jacket) carry the color or visual punch, while the other two layers exist in understated tones — black, white, grey, cream, or navy. For instance, a Palm Angels tee with the house’s flame graphic in red and orange, layered under a black hoodie and a grey overcoat, keeps the fit grounded and lets the tee’s design pop through the open layers. On the other hand, you can go full tonal by keeping all three layers within the same color family at varying tones — an off-white tee, a cream hoodie, and a camel overcoat delivers a sophisticated monochromatic look that seems stunningly high-end. The Bold Tailoring Combination
One of the most effective ways to wear Palm Angels tees in 2026 is underneath formal pieces — blazers, sport coats, and structured vests. This high-low interplay is the bedrock of current luxury streetwear styling, and Palm Angels tees are perfectly equipped to it because their premium feel is visible and undeniable. A $350 Palm Angels printed tee under a tailored blazer projects that the wearer appreciates fashion well enough to break rules with confidence. The design glimpsed from beneath a tailored lapel delivers tension between tradition and subversion that is infinitely interesting to observe. When creating this combination, fit is paramount: the tee should be relaxed but not overly long, and the blazer should have a relaxed, slightly deconstructed cut. A slim, excessively structured business blazer will collide uncomfortably with the tee’s streetwear DNA, but a casual Italian-cut blazer with natural shoulders establishes perfect synergy.
This look has been broadly picked up by style-conscious professionals in progressive industries — advertising, music, tech, and design — where dress codes are flexible enough to accommodate this kind of creativity. The look performs just as well at a museum opening, a romantic date, or a corporate meeting in a innovative industry. For the lower half, dress trousers in a understated tone finish the outfit with elegance, while Palm Angels track pants preserve a more informal mood. Either choice works, and the choice depends on the exact context and the message you want to make. Warm Weather Layering
Layering in warm weather might sound odd, but it is vital for putting together sharp warm-weather ensembles that exceed the simple tee-and-shorts look. The critical factor is choosing featherweight layers that add stylistic complexity without creating heat. An open mesh or airy vest over a Palm Angels tee provides structural interest and an extra surface for creative or color expression. Palm Angels has included mesh tank overlays and perforated nylon vests in current seasons ($350 to $550), and these pieces are purposely created for warm-weather layering. Another impactful strategy is the tied-around-waist layer: take a Palm Angels hoodie or light jacket and drape it around your waist over a designer tee. This provides color and shape to the bottom portion of your silhouette while keeping the tee fully visible. It is a styling hack taken directly from the skate culture that created the house, giving it credible roots within the Palm Angels ecosystem.
Accessories function as detail layers in warm weather. A Palm Angels bucket hat provides a top layer that crowns the face and ties the outfit together creatively. A crossbody bag carried on a slant across the chest builds a dimensional effect over the tee while addressing a useful need. Layered necklaces — a combination of chains at multiple lengths — add dimension at the chest that counteracts the limited number of garment layers. The aim in summer layering is to deliver the same creative interest as a multi-garment winter outfit using minimal, less heavy, and more accessory-focused elements. Each element should be thoughtful: if it does not add something meaningful to the final look, leave it off.
Cool Weather Layering
Winter is where layering actually excels, and Palm Angels tees operate as the indispensable base layer that every cold-weather look is assembled upon. The brand’s substantial cotton delivers real insulation — noticeably more than a basic fast-fashion tee — making it a performance as well as style choice for base layering. Start with a slim Palm Angels tee against the skin, add a crewneck sweatshirt or fine knit sweater as a mid-layer, and round out with a solid outer layer like the Moncler x Palm Angels puffer or a wool-blend overcoat. In very cold conditions (below minus 5 degrees Celsius), you can add a extra layer — a zip-up fleece or vest between the mid-layer and outer layer — without the outfit coming across as too much, so long as each layer is chosen with attention to fit graduation.

Pro Guidance for Polishing Your Layered Ensembles
After years of watching how the most polished Palm Angels wearers put together their combinations, several key rules reveal themselves that set apart decent layering from great layering. First, always think about the “reveal” — the part of each layer that stays visible in the complete outfit. If you are wearing three layers, each one should have at least a glimpse of visible fabric, whether at the top, hem, or sleeves. Roll, push, or adjust until every layer signals its presence. Second, focus on fabric materials across layers. The best layered ensembles blend at least two diverse textures — cotton with nylon, knit with denim, fleece with leather. This surface range builds stylistic richness that a single-fabric outfit cannot deliver. Third, do not fear asymmetry. Sliding one sleeve up, allowing a tee fall marginally longer on one side, or wearing a jacket tossed over one shoulder adds the kind of casual nonchalance that makes street style photography so compelling.
Finally, don’t forget that layering is at its core personal. The approaches presented in this resource are frameworks, not unbreakable commandments.
